- Two roofers, two hours
- Clean, reseal, nothing that uses any significant consumables
- Replace 5 Marley interlocking tiles
- Swap out old skylight with new one (new one already in my shed)

I've been verbally quoted £320 cash.

Does that sound like a reasonable price?

this subject comes up regular on this forum, thats why its always advisable to get 2 or 3 estimates.

dont forget its not only 2 men 2 hrs you will be paying for their traveling time and overheads, public liability, van,equipment, and office etc.
thats if they are legit of course.

personally i think that price is reasonable all considered.
